Operate, monitor, and adjust manufacturing and packaging equipment following standard operating procedures (SOPs). Perform routine quality checks and accurately complete production and batch documentation. Conduct basic equipment troubleshooting and report issues to supervisors or maintenance. Maintain a clean, organized, and sanitary work area in compliance with GMP and food safety standards. Assist with equipment changeovers, cleaning, and preventive maintenance while following all safety and PPE requirements.

Machine Operator

Qualifications:

Experience working in a manufacturing or food production environment; prior food manufacturing experience required. Ability to use basic hand tools (such as a wrench or screwdriver) and perform basic equipment troubleshooting. Ability to lift, push, or pull up to 50 pounds, stand for extended periods, and perform repetitive physical tasks safely. Ability to read, write, and communicate in English for safety, training, and production documentation.

Willingness to complete two weeks of paid training on 1st shift, work mandatory overtime as required, follow a strict food-production dress code, and wear PPE; no formal degree required.
